titleOfInvention | All-weather adhesive tape for pressure applications |
abstract | A plasticised PVC insulating tape is claimed to combine full utility at subzero temperatures without loss of quality in handling or insulating properties at higher temperatures. The film backing contains a large amount of a polyester plasticiser with or without other plasticiser, so as to have, at -20 deg.C., a modulus at 50% elongation less than 5300 p.s.i. and brittleness not more than twice at 0 deg.C. On this is deposited a pressure sensitive adhesive which has very high viscosity and cohesive energy density less than 75 cals/cc. |
